logo

Output 7d20af1456613ddbaaa1c3e6a1fecced7feeeb3f4615f8113b4c0ab071678990:1

value
609041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4338b75672a8a92ad6dec14581f63a73e5191e52 OP_EQUAL
address
37pT971hGCt8ScRDN6VVTYQqjFrgefdNyh
transaction
7d20af1456613ddbaaa1c3e6a1fecced7feeeb3f4615f8113b4c0ab071678990